What does the following program segment do? Declare Count As Integer Declare Sum As Integer Set Sum = 0 For (Count = 1; Count < 50; Count++) Set Sum = Sum + Count End For

1225

Explanation:

This segment helps initialize sum as 0. The for loop is used to increment with every execution and it is added to the sum. The loop runs 49 times and every time the count is added to the sum. In short it is the sum of first 49 natural numbers i.e 1+2+3+......+49.
